Get started7 Park Road is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Little Lever, Bolton, Bolton (BL3 1DP). It has a recorded floor area of 63 m² (around 678 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band A.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(April 2022)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(April 2012);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. Sale prices here have outpaced Bolton HPI: 8.5%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£162,000 is 14.1% above the 2024 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£209/sq ft) was about 46.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£142,000 in July 2024.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 63 m² it's 23.6%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(83 m² median across 14 EPCs).
